Softcover. White & color illus. stapled wraps. 56 pp. 6 color, 42 bw plates. Essays on each artist and 1-page introduction by Judy Collischan Van Wagner. This exhibition highlights 3 women who have chosen nature as a source for the subject, media or content of their work. Nancy Brett's more "realistic" paintings use specific features from a particular site to convey its romantic impact upon her. Shalvah Segal also uses landscape, but she forms stark and subtle abstractions, her own perceptual response to an Israeli desert. Meg Webster uses natural matter to construct three-dimensional, minimalist parallels to natural phenomenon. Includes professional information for each artist (education, exhibitions, bibliography, awards, collections, commissions). Paperback. Condition: Very Good. Drawing In Situ, the catalog for an exhibition curated by Carol Becker Davis at the Hillwood Art Gallery. Seven artists created an exhibition in about a week by drawing directly on the gallery walls. The process was documented by photographer Ken La x. Artists were Ida Applebroog, Judith Bernstein, John Fekner, Stevan Jennis, John Parcher, William Ramage and Paul Fortunato. 48 pages, color and black and white, spiral bound, slick paper with stiff cover.
